Output 3b95bc30df0b0cc63e8781b17a8be11cb15b01dcccb25c83eefd7a566b51c72b:3

value
16590514
script pubkey
OP_0 OP_PUSHBYTES_32 5e55e61e56a014f4a47f6d6ab6c163c1c88977e919438b9522fac36bbb621a40
address
bc1qte27v8jk5q20ffrld44tdstrc8ygjalfr9pch9fzltpkhwmzrfqq95w77e
transaction
3b95bc30df0b0cc63e8781b17a8be11cb15b01dcccb25c83eefd7a566b51c72b
spent
true